What safety equipment is essential when working on live electrical systems?

Explanation:
When working on live electrical systems, the safety of the individual is paramount. The correct answer highlights the necessity of using insulated tools, personal protective equipment (PPE), and voltage-rated gloves. Insulated tools are specifically designed to prevent electrical current from passing through the body and causing injury. These tools have protective insulating material covering the components that might come in contact with live circuits, which is crucial for safety when dealing with high voltage. Personal protective equipment plays a vital role in ensuring that a worker is safeguarded against electrical hazards. This generally includes items such as helmets, face shields, and safety glasses, which protect from potential electrical arcs or flash. Voltage-rated gloves are essential for protecting the hands from electric shock. These gloves are tested and certified to protect against specific voltage levels, making them critical when handling live wires or components.
